WebLine weight is the thickness of the line on the page. A heavy line will represent cutting planes and contours of an object, like a wall for example. A medium or lighter weight line is used for secondary emphasis. Thin lines are used for dimension lines, leaders, door swings and break lines. Side note, AutoCAD is not the only design software to have “Layers” functionality, other popular design software also boasts such as Adobe … david prouty high school 50th reunion 2023Web1 mrt. 2024 · Enter LAYER on the command line. Alternatively, on the ribbon in AutoCAD, click the Home tab Layers Panel Layer Properties. In the Layer Properties Manager, under the Lineweight column, click the lineweight to change.
